State Department Says U.S.
Can't Ask Extradition of Lansky

WASHINGTON (JTA) —
The U.S. Government wants
to put Meyer Lansky on trial
for tax evasion and contempt
of court but apparently will
not ask Israel to extradite
the 70-year-old reputed gang-
land boss.
This was indicated Tues-
day by state department
spokesman Charles Bray who
said the U.S. could not do
much formally to bring
about Lansly6s extradition.
He said the charges against
Lansky are not an extra-
ditable offense under the
U.S.-Israel Treaty of 1962.
Bray discussed the Issue

following a ruling by the Is-
raeli Supreme Court in Jer-
usalem Monday upholding
the government's decision to
, expel Lansky.

Lansky, a Russian-born
Jew and a naturalized citi-
zen of the U.S. went to Israel
in 1970 on a tourist visa and
subsequently applied for citi-
zenship under the law of re-
turn. The interior ministry
rejected his bid on grounds
of his criminal past.

In Jerusalem Wednesday,
Lansky said he was "at a
loss" about what to do or
where to go as a result of
the Supreme Court ruling.





1943 Psychoanalytic Study
of Hitler Revealed in New Book

Twenty-nine years after a
secret study of Hitler was
made by an American psy-
choanalyst, the information
has been released and now
is in the form of a book to
be released Sept. 22.
The book, "The Mind of
Adolf Hitler," is authored by
Dr. Walter C. Langer and is
published by Basic Books.
Dr. Langer investigated
the mind of Adolf Hitler for
six months in 1943. He was
gathering intelligence for the
Allies, interviewing people
who knew Hitler and were
available to the intelligence
agencies of the United States.

LONDON (JTA) — Presi-
dent Idi Amin of Uganda
praised Hitler for killing
6,000,000 Jews in a telegram
he sent Tuesday to Secre-
tary-General Kurt Waldheim
and claimed Britain should
solve the Middle East prob-
lem by settling Israelis in
Britain and leaving Palestine
to the Palestinians.
The vitriolic message was
handed to Robert Gardiner,
executive secretary of the
UN Economic Commission
for Africa in Kampala and
copies were sent to Premier
Golda Meir of Israel and El
Fatah leader Yassir Arafat.

Guinness, an actor for 40
years, sees ingredients of a
pre-Hitler atmosphere in the
United States and England.
"If you look around Lon-
don now, it's not very far
from what Berlin was in the
'20s," he says. "The afflu-
ence, the frivolity, the great
lack of law and order. These
are the ingredients that
could give rise to another
Hitler. Don't forget that to
begin with, Hitler appealed
to perfectly sensible, liberal-
minded people.
"As an actor," he said, "I
cannot possibly make Hitler

be smart and think this can't
happen again."
Sir Alec Guinness' words
tell of the seriousness and
hard work he is putting into
the title role in a new film,
"Hitler: The Last Ten Days."
"Until now, I never really
made a study of Hitler," the
English actor told New York
Times interviewer John
Gruen. "I've done a great
deal of reading, and I've
talked with Herr Boldt from
Hamburg, who was with Hit-
ler for eight of those famous
